A solid conducting sphere of radius 10 cm is enclosed by a thin metallic shell of radius 20 cm. A charge q=20 μ C is given to the inner sphere. Find the heat generated in the process when the inner sphere is connected to the shell by a conducting wire :

Solution

The correct option is B 9 J
On connecting, the entire amount of charge will shift to the outer sphere. Heat generated is
UiUf=q28πε0R1q28πε0R2

=(20×106)×9×1092[10.1010.20]=9J
